New hope for kids with rare liver tumors: tailored therapy trial shows promise

NCT ID NCT03017326

First seen May 16, 2026 · Last updated Jun 09, 2026 · Updated 6 times

Summary

This study tests different treatment plans based on each child's risk level for two rare liver cancers: hepatoblastoma and hepatocellular carcinoma. About 450 children will receive chemotherapy and possibly surgery, with the goal of preventing the cancer from coming back. The approach aims to give the right amount of treatment to each child to improve outcomes while reducing side effects.
